Can you beat Roulette RNG?

Legitimate techniques beat roulette, but RNG roulette is not roulette. It may look like it with those fancy animations, but essentially it is a slot machine. The only people ever to have won consistently at slot machines are people that use cheating devices such as the light wand. This is a device that blinds the coin counting mechanism in a slot machine, so that the machine doesn’t know when to stop paying out. That the whole other story. My point is that you can’t beat a slot machine with a system, and it is no different with RNG roulette. Suppose you are betting on animations of bouncing bunnies, instead of a roulette wheel – it would be no different.

Using maths to beat roulette

The great majority of roulette systems attempt to use mathematics to beat roulette. And without knowing it, the system designer usually attempts to find a way around the mathematical certainty. Almost every roulette strategy makes the same mistakes. For example, on a European roulette wheel, there are 37 pockets, but the payout is unfair 35 to 1. So even if you win, you are still paid an unfair amount. So a win is still a loss. The only way around this is to increase the accuracy of your predictions. No maths is going to resolve this problem, unless pertains directly to increasing the accuracy of predictions.

In professional roulette system methods, of course mathematics is still involved, but in the correct way. For example, a proper statistical analysis.

Correct use of mathematics to analyse a roulette system would of course reveal whether or not a system is a legitimate long-term winner. A simple application of maths would be as follows:

Consider a situation where our player believed that after 10 Reds in a row, that black is most likely to spin next. This is an age old gamblers fallacy. The reality is even after 100 Reds in a row, the odds of red or black spinning next are essentially the same, of course assuming that there is in some physical defect of the wheel. If the player conducted a statistical analysis over enough situations where they believed the odds have changed, they would find they haven’t changed.

Can you beat roulette machines?

Rapid roulette usually involves a real wheel and dealer, although sometimes there are automatic wheels that don’t require a dealer.

Roulette machines, otherwise known as automated roulette machines, are still roulette wheels although the ball is spun by a robot using an air compressor or magnet. With such wheels, physics is still involved although there is a greater element of randomness. Can a roulette strategy beat them? This all depends on the method you use to predict the spins. In most cases or rather with traditional advanced play methods, the inbuilt countermeasures from roulette machines do significantly reduce the players edge, and in many cases may completely eliminate edge. But in most cases they act more as a deterrent to professional players, and do not completely eliminate players edge. In this respect they act much like an alarm system on a house (with the flashing light box out front), where it may not keep a burglar out of your house, but will encourage a burglar to try elsewhere where conditions are easier.

Electronic Roulette Machines

The operation of electronic roulette machines is very simple. As in any roulette game, your goal is to guess on which number the ball will land.

The electronic roulette software is based on an electronic circuit where an air blower launches the ball and rotating plates accelerate its movement. The ball is launched around 60-80 times per hour, which is approximately every 30-45 seconds. Although this varies from one model to another. The electronic roulette machine has an auto roulette wheel in the centre and bet terminals with touch screens located around it. Despite what many think, they do not use magnets, instead, the system has optical and proximity sensors that detect the position of the ball.

The wheel is covered with a protective cover to prevent any type of tampering, damage or unauthorized access. This game of chance can accomodate several players at once although it is also possible to find individual electronic roulette games.

Electronic Roulette Bets

Before you start playing, you have to know about the different roulette bets. In the electronic version, you do not place your chips on a table, instead you must use an electronic screen.

Some machines have systems of protection against simultaneous bets, so they do not allow you to bet identical sums on opposite positions like black/red, odd/even, low/high, etc. If such bets are made, a warning message will appear stating that the bet is not valid and the player must withdraw or modify their bet in order to continue the game.

Casinos usually include new and different bets on their electronic roulettes. But in general, you can bet on the 37 numbers with simple bets such as black/red, lower (1-18) / higher (19-36), odd/even or combination bets.

You can combine inside bets with outside bets. Inside bets are:

  • Trio is a bet on the first three numbers eg: 0, 1 and 2 or 0, 2 and 3.
  • Split is a bet on two numbers that are beside each other on the betting table eg: the line between 25 and 28 puts a bet on both numbers.
  • Street is a bet on three numbers that are in a row eg: 7, 8, 9 or 19, 20, 21.
  • Corner is a bet for four numbers that are in a square eg: 17, 18, 20 and 21.
  • Sixline is the bet for six numbers that form a rectangle, if you place your chips where the line below 31 and 34 and the line between 31 and 34 make a T, you will be betting on 31, 32, 33, 34, 35 & 36.

Outside bets:

  • Column is a bet on one of the three rows of numbers as shown on the betting area.
  • Dozen is a bet for the first, second or third dozen numbers (1-12, 13-24 or 25-36).

Electronic Roulette Manufacturers

There are several electronic roulette developers:

  • Fazi is the leading developer of electronic roulette in the Balkans. Their games include Optimum, Key One, Zed and Triple Crown.
  • Novomatic stands out for its 24 terminal electronic roulette that can be found in some of the larger casinos around the world.
  • Picmatic is a Spanish developer that since 1984 has been developing arcade machines and roulettes. Among them are Red Winner Roulette and Bill Roulette.
  • The company Interblock, based in Slovenia, has developed Diamond Roulette and Organic Roulette. In addition Interblock has also created Chinese roulette and individual electronic roulette machines.
  • IGT has created electronic roulette machines with one and two zeros.

Despite the different roulette models that we can find in the market, the latest generation electronic roulettes have some common characteristics:

  • They use three sensors to quickly detect where the ball falls.
  • They include an automatic change of the ball.
  • The wheel has a high hardness coverage with carbon fiber and several highly reliable fraud prevention systems.

Electronic Roulette Games

There are two main types of electronic roulette games, the European version (with a zero) and the American version (with two zeroes). European roulette has 37 numbers, 18 red, 18 black and one zero, and American roulette has 38 numbers, 18 red, 18 black and two zeroes.

As the electronic European roulette has 37 numbers (from 0 to 36), this gives an advantage to the casino of 1/37 or 2.70%. While the American roulette, which has 38 numbers, gives the casino an advantage of 2/38 or 5.26%.
